+// Package navigation provides the menu functionality.
+package navigation
+
+import (
+ "html/template"
+ "sort"
+
+ "github.com/gohugoio/hugo/common/maps"
+ "github.com/gohugoio/hugo/common/types"
+ "github.com/gohugoio/hugo/compare"
+ "github.com/gohugoio/hugo/config"
+ "github.com/mitchellh/mapstructure"
+
+ "github.com/spf13/cast"
+)
+
+var smc = newMenuCache()
+
+// MenuEntry represents a menu item defined in either Page front matter
+// or in the site config.
+type MenuEntry struct {
+ // The menu entry configuration.
+ MenuConfig
+
+ // The menu containing this menu entry.
+ Menu string
+
+ // The URL value from front matter / config.
+ ConfiguredURL string
+
+ // The Page connected to this menu entry.
+ Page Page
+
+ // Child entries.
+ Children Menu
+}
+
+func (m *MenuEntry) URL() string {
+
+ // Check page first.
+ // In Hugo 0.86.0 we added `pageRef`,
+ // a way to connect menu items in site config to pages.
+ // This means that you now can have both a Page
+ // and a configured URL.
+ // Having the configured URL as a fallback if the Page isn't found
+ // is obviously more useful, especially in multilingual sites.
+ if !types.IsNil(m.Page) {
+ return m.Page.RelPermalink()
+ }
+
+ return m.ConfiguredURL
+}
+
+// SetPageValues sets the Page and URL values for this menu entry.
+func SetPageValues(m *MenuEntry, p Page) {
+ m.Page = p
+ if m.MenuConfig.Name == "" {
+ m.MenuConfig.Name = p.LinkTitle()
+ }
+ if m.MenuConfig.Title == "" {
+ m.MenuConfig.Title = p.Title()
+ }
+ if m.MenuConfig.Weight == 0 {
+ m.MenuConfig.Weight = p.Weight()
+ }
+}
+
+// A narrow version of page.Page.
+type Page interface {
+ LinkTitle() string
+ Title() string
+ RelPermalink() string
+ Path() string
+ Section() string
+ Weight() int
+ IsPage() bool
+ IsSection() bool
+ IsAncestor(other any) (bool, error)
+ Params() maps.Params
+}
+
+// Menu is a collection of menu entries.
+type Menu []*MenuEntry
+
+// Menus is a dictionary of menus.
+type Menus map[string]Menu
+
+// PageMenus is a dictionary of menus defined in the Pages.
+type PageMenus map[string]*MenuEntry
+
+// HasChildren returns whether this menu item has any children.
+func (m *MenuEntry) HasChildren() bool {
+ return m.Children != nil
+}
+
+// KeyName returns the key used to identify this menu entry.
+func (m *MenuEntry) KeyName() string {
+ if m.Identifier != "" {
+ return m.Identifier
+ }
+ return m.Name
+}
+
+func (m *MenuEntry) hopefullyUniqueID() string {
+ if m.Identifier != "" {
+ return m.Identifier
+ } else if m.URL() != "" {
+ return m.URL()
+ } else {
+ return m.Name
+ }
+}
+
+// isEqual returns whether the two menu entries represents the same menu entry.
+func (m *MenuEntry) isEqual(inme *MenuEntry) bool {
+ return m.hopefullyUniqueID() == inme.hopefullyUniqueID() && m.Parent == inme.Parent
+}
+
+// isSameResource returns whether the two menu entries points to the same
+// resource (URL).
+func (m *MenuEntry) isSameResource(inme *MenuEntry) bool {
+ if m.isSamePage(inme.Page) {
+ return m.Page == inme.Page
+ }
+ murl, inmeurl := m.URL(), inme.URL()
+ return murl != "" && inmeurl != "" && murl == inmeurl
+}
+
+func (m *MenuEntry) isSamePage(p Page) bool {
+ if !types.IsNil(m.Page) && !types.IsNil(p) {
+ return m.Page == p
+ }
+ return false
+}
+
+// MenuConfig holds the configuration for a menu.
+type MenuConfig struct {
+ Identifier string
+ Parent string
+ Name string
+ Pre template.HTML
+ Post template.HTML
+ URL string
+ PageRef string
+ Weight int
+ Title string
+ // User defined params.
+ Params maps.Params
+}
+
+// For internal use.
+
+// This is for internal use only.
+func (m Menu) Add(me *MenuEntry) Menu {
+ m = append(m, me)
+ // TODO(bep)
+ m.Sort()
+ return m
+}
+
+/*
+ * Implementation of a custom sorter for Menu
+ */
+
+// A type to implement the sort interface for Menu
+type menuSorter struct {
+ menu Menu
+ by menuEntryBy
+}
+
+// Closure used in the Sort.Less method.
+type menuEntryBy func(m1, m2 *MenuEntry) bool
+
+func (by menuEntryBy) Sort(menu Menu) {
+ ms := &menuSorter{
+ menu: menu,
+ by: by, // The Sort method's receiver is the function (closure) that defines the sort order.
+ }
+ sort.Stable(ms)
+}
+
+var defaultMenuEntrySort = func(m1, m2 *MenuEntry) bool {
+ if m1.Weight == m2.Weight {
+ c := compare.Strings(m1.Name, m2.Name)
+ if c == 0 {
+ return m1.Identifier < m2.Identifier
+ }
+ return c < 0
+ }
+
+ if m2.Weight == 0 {
+ return true
+ }
+
+ if m1.Weight == 0 {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 return m1.Weight < m2.Weight
+}
+
+func (ms *menuSorter) Len() int { return len(ms.menu) }
+func (ms *menuSorter) Swap(i, j int) { ms.menu[i], ms.menu[j] = ms.menu[j], ms.menu[i] }
+
+// Less is part of sort.Interface. It is implemented by calling the "by" closure in the sorter.
+func (ms *menuSorter) Less(i, j int) bool { return ms.by(ms.menu[i], ms.menu[j]) }
+
+// Sort sorts the menu by weight, name and then by identifier.
+func (m Menu) Sort() Menu {
+ menuEntryBy(defaultMenuEntrySort).Sort(m)
+ return m
+}
+
+// Limit limits the returned menu to n entries.
+func (m Menu) Limit(n int) Menu {
+ if len(m) > n {
+ return m[0:n]
+ }
+ return m
+}
+
+// ByWeight sorts the menu by the weight defined in the menu configuration.
+func (m Menu) ByWeight() Menu {
+ const key = "menuSort.ByWeight"
+ menus, _ := smc.get(key, menuEntryBy(defaultMenuEntrySort).Sort, m)
+
+ return menus
+}
+
+// ByName sorts the menu by the name defined in the menu configuration.
+func (m Menu) ByName() Menu {
+ const key = "menuSort.ByName"
+ title := func(m1, m2 *MenuEntry) bool {
+ return compare.LessStrings(m1.Name, m2.Name)
+ }
+
+ menus, _ := smc.get(key, menuEntryBy(title).Sort, m)
+
+ return menus
+}
+
+// Reverse reverses the order of the menu entries.
+func (m Menu) Reverse() Menu {
+ const key = "menuSort.Reverse"
+ reverseFunc := func(menu Menu) {
+ for i, j := 0, len(menu)-1; i < j; i, j = i+1, j-1 {
+ menu[i], menu[j] = menu[j], menu[i]
+ }
+ }
+ menus, _ := smc.get(key, reverseFunc, m)
+
+ return menus
+}
+
+// Clone clones the menu entries.
+// This is for internal use only.
+func (m Menu) Clone() Menu {
+ return append(Menu(nil), m...)
+}
+
+func DecodeConfig(in any) (*config.ConfigNamespace[map[string]MenuConfig, Menus], error) {
+ buildConfig := func(in any) (Menus, any, error) {
+ ret := Menus{}
+
+ if in == nil {
+ return ret, map[string]any{}, nil
+ }
+
+ menus, err := maps.ToStringMapE(in)
+ if err != nil {
+ return ret, nil, err
+ }
+ menus = maps.CleanConfigStringMap(menus)
+
+ for name, menu := range menus {
+ m, err := cast.ToSliceE(menu)
+ if err != nil {
+ return ret, nil, err
+ } else {
+
+ for _, entry := range m {
+ var menuConfig MenuConfig
+ if err := mapstructure.WeakDecode(entry, &menuConfig); err != nil {
+ return ret, nil, err
+ }
+ maps.PrepareParams(menuConfig.Params)
+ menuEntry := MenuEntry{
+ Menu: name,
+ MenuConfig: menuConfig,
+ }
+ menuEntry.ConfiguredURL = menuEntry.MenuConfig.URL
+
+ if ret[name] == nil {
+ ret[name] = Menu{}
+ }
+ ret[name] = ret[name].Add(&menuEntry)
+ }
+ }
+ }
+
+ return ret, menus, nil
+
+ }
+
+ return config.DecodeNamespace[map[string]MenuConfig](in, buildConfig)
+}

+package navigation
+
+import (
+ "sync"
+)
+
+type menuCacheEntry struct {
+ in []Menu
+ out Menu
+}
+
+func (entry menuCacheEntry) matches(menuList []Menu) bool {
+ if len(entry.in) != len(menuList) {
+ return false
+ }
+ for i, m := range menuList {
+ if !menuEqual(m, entry.in[i]) {
+ return false
+ }
+ }
+
+ return true
+}
+
+func newMenuCache() *menuCache {
+ return &menuCache{m: make(map[string][]menuCacheEntry)}
+}
+
+func (c *menuCache) clear() {
+ c.Lock()
+ defer c.Unlock()
+ c.m = make(map[string][]menuCacheEntry)
+}
+
+type menuCache struct {
+ sync.RWMutex
+ m map[string][]menuCacheEntry
+}
+
+func menuEqual(m1, m2 Menu) bool {
+ if m1 == nil && m2 == nil {
+ return true
+ }
+
+ if m1 == nil || m2 == nil {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 if len(m1) != len(m2) {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 if len(m1) == 0 {
+ return true
+ }
+
+ for i := 0; i < len(m1); i++ {
+ if m1[i] != m2[i] {
+ return false
+ }
+ }
+ return true
+}
+
+func (c *menuCache) get(key string, apply func(m Menu), menuLists ...Menu) (Menu, bool) {
+ return c.getP(key, func(m *Menu) {
+ if apply != nil {
+ apply(*m)
+ }
+ }, menuLists...)
+}
+
+func (c *menuCache) getP(key string, apply func(m *Menu), menuLists ...Menu) (Menu, bool) {
+ c.Lock()
+ defer c.Unlock()
+
+ if cached, ok := c.m[key]; ok {
+ for _, entry := range cached {
+ if entry.matches(menuLists) {
+ return entry.out, true
+ }
+ }
+ }
+
+ m := menuLists[0]
+ menuCopy := append(Menu(nil), m...)
+
+ if apply != nil {
+ apply(&menuCopy)
+ }
+
+ entry := menuCacheEntry{in: menuLists, out: menuCopy}
+ if v, ok := c.m[key]; ok {
+ c.m[key] = append(v, entry)
+ } else {
+ c.m[key] = []menuCacheEntry{entry}
+ }
+
+ return menuCopy, false
+}

+package navigation
+
+import (
+ "fmt"
+
+ "github.com/gohugoio/hugo/common/maps"
+ "github.com/gohugoio/hugo/common/types"
+ "github.com/mitchellh/mapstructure"
+
+ "github.com/spf13/cast"
+)
+
+type PageMenusProvider interface {
+ PageMenusGetter
+ MenuQueryProvider
+}
+
+type PageMenusGetter interface {
+ Menus() PageMenus
+}
+
+type MenusGetter interface {
+ Menus() Menus
+}
+
+type MenuQueryProvider interface {
+ HasMenuCurrent(menuID string, me *MenuEntry) bool
+ IsMenuCurrent(menuID string, inme *MenuEntry) bool
+}
+
+func PageMenusFromPage(p Page) (PageMenus, error) {
+ params := p.Params()
+
+ ms, ok := params["menus"]
+ if !ok {
+ ms, ok = params["menu"]
+ }
+
+ pm := PageMenus{}
+
+ if !ok {
+ return nil, nil
+ }
+
+ me := MenuEntry{}
+ SetPageValues(&me, p)
+
+ // Could be the name of the menu to attach it to
+ mname, err := cast.ToStringE(ms)
+
+ if err == nil {
+ me.Menu = mname
+ pm[mname] = &me
+ return pm, nil
+ }
+
+ // Could be a slice of strings
+ mnames, err := cast.ToStringSliceE(ms)
+
+ if err == nil {
+ for _, mname := range mnames {
+ me.Menu = mname
+ pm[mname] = &me
+ }
+ return pm, nil
+ }
+
+ var wrapErr = func(err error) error {
+ return fmt.Errorf("unable to process menus for page %q: %w", p.Path(), err)
+ }
+
+ // Could be a structured menu entry
+ menus, err := maps.ToStringMapE(ms)
+ if err != nil {
+ return pm, wrapErr(err)
+ }
+
+ for name, menu := range menus {
+ menuEntry := MenuEntry{Menu: name}
+ if menu != nil {
+ ime, err := maps.ToStringMapE(menu)
+ if err != nil {
+ return pm, wrapErr(err)
+ }
+ if err := mapstructure.WeakDecode(ime, &menuEntry.MenuConfig); err != nil {
+ return pm, err
+ }
+ }
+ SetPageValues(&menuEntry, p)
+ pm[name] = &menuEntry
+ }
+
+ return pm, nil
+}
+
+func NewMenuQueryProvider(
+ pagem PageMenusGetter,
+ sitem MenusGetter,
+ p Page) MenuQueryProvider {
+ return &pageMenus{
+ p: p,
+ pagem: pagem,
+ sitem: sitem,
+ }
+}
+
+type pageMenus struct {
+ pagem PageMenusGetter
+ sitem MenusGetter
+ p Page
+}
+
+func (pm *pageMenus) HasMenuCurrent(menuID string, me *MenuEntry) bool {
+ if !types.IsNil(me.Page) && me.Page.IsSection() {
+ if ok, _ := me.Page.IsAncestor(pm.p); ok {
+ return true
+ }
+ }
+
+ if !me.HasChildren() {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 menus := pm.pagem.Menus()
+
+ if m, ok := menus[menuID]; ok {
+ for _, child := range me.Children {
+ if child.isEqual(m) {
+ return true
+ }
+ if pm.HasMenuCurrent(menuID, child) {
+ return true
+ }
+ }
+ }
+
+ if pm.p == nil {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 for _, child := range me.Children {
+ if child.isSamePage(pm.p) {
+ return true
+ }
+
+ if pm.HasMenuCurrent(menuID, child) {
+ return true
+ }
+ }
+
+ return false
+}
+
+func (pm *pageMenus) IsMenuCurrent(menuID string, inme *MenuEntry) bool {
+ menus := pm.pagem.Menus()
+
+ if me, ok := menus[menuID]; ok {
+ if me.isEqual(inme) {
+ return true
+ }
+ }
+
+ if pm.p == nil {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 if !inme.isSamePage(pm.p) {
+ return false
+ }
+
+ // This resource may be included in several menus.
+ // Search for it to make sure that it is in the menu with the given menuId.
+ if menu, ok := pm.sitem.Menus()[menuID]; ok {
+ for _, menuEntry := range menu {
+ if menuEntry.isSameResource(inme) {
+ return true
+ }
+
+ descendantFound := pm.isSameAsDescendantMenu(inme, menuEntry)
+ if descendantFound {
+ return descendantFound
+ }
+
+ }
+ }
+
+ return false
+}
+
+func (pm *pageMenus) isSameAsDescendantMenu(inme *MenuEntry, parent *MenuEntry) bool {
+ if parent.HasChildren() {
+ for _, child := range parent.Children {
+ if child.isSameResource(inme) {
+ return true
+ }
+ descendantFound := pm.isSameAsDescendantMenu(inme, child)
+ if descendantFound {
+ return descendantFound
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 return false
+}
+
+var NopPageMenus = new(nopPageMenus)
+
+type nopPageMenus int
+
+func (m nopPageMenus) Menus() PageMenus {
+ return PageMenus{}
+}
+
+func (m nopPageMenus) HasMenuCurrent(menuID string, me *MenuEntry) bool {
+ return false
+}
+
+func (m nopPageMenus) IsMenuCurrent(menuID string, inme *MenuEntry) bool {
+ return false
+}
